Tip #1: Use a Good Razor for Shaving

It's amazing we see how many people spend so much time on shaving every day for years, but they never give much thought to their #1 most important tool: their razor (or electric shaver).
If you use a razor, you know there are lots of razor brands in the market so it's easy to get confused which one is right for you.
The best way to go is to try the top 3-5 most popular brands you see and see if if they suit your skin and can remove your hair easily.
If you want to use an electric shaver to remove your pubic hair, it is important that you find the right on for you too.
Note: In case you are wondering, yes, it is possible to use an electric shaver to remove your pubic hair down there. Actually myself and a few other friends used to do it for years and it was effective.
The key is just finding the right type of shaver for that area because the skin is sensitive and regular shavers like male ones will irritate your skin.

Tip #2: Soak Your Pubic Area before Shaving

Water and wetting your pubic area skin and hair will make it smoother to shave that area.

Tip #3: Moisturize Your Skin after Shaving

After shaving your pubic hair, your skin will be more sensitive and you need to take special care of it. Moisturizing your skin helps doing it.
